Star Wars: Battlefront Xbox One blurb offers scant new insight

Star Wars: Battlefront has an Xbox One product page on Xbox.com, and it offers a small, anorexic taste of what's in store from the DICE-developed shooter.

You'll find the Star Wars: Battlefront page through the link.

The product descriptor reads, "Relive and participate in all of the classic Star Wars battles like never before. Play as one of a number of different soldier types, jump into any vehicle, man any turret on the battlefront, and conquer the galaxy, planet by planet."

Sounds like Battlefront then.
